异次网

您现在的位置是:主页 > 问题排查 >

问题排查

如何限制dblink

发布时间:2026-03-30 16:39:53问题排查
在数据库管理中,数据库链接(dblink)的合理限制对于保障数据安全、优化性能和提升运维效率至关重要。小编将围绕如何限制dblink这一问题,从多个角度详细阐述解决方案,帮助您更好地管理数据库链接。一、限制dblink的连接数量1.1为什么要限制连接数量?过多的数据库链接会占用服务器资源,影响数据库性能。限制连接数量可以有效防止资源浪费,确保数据库稳定运行。...

在数据库管理中,数据库链接(dblink)的合理限制对于保障数据安全、优化性能和提升运维效率至关重要。小编将围绕如何限制dblink这一问题,从多个角度详细阐述解决方案,帮助您更好地管理数据库链接。

一、限制dblink的连接数量

1.1为什么要限制连接数量?

过多的数据库链接会占用服务器资源,影响数据库性能。限制连接数量可以有效防止资源浪费,确保数据库稳定运行。

1.2如何限制连接数量?

-设置最大连接数:在数据库配置文件中设置最大连接数,超出该限制的新连接将无法建立。

-使用连接池:通过连接池技术,统一管理数据库连接,实现连接复用,减少连接创建和销毁的开销。

二、限制dblink的访问权限

2.1为什么要限制访问权限?

限制访问权限可以有效防止非法访问和数据泄露,保障数据安全。

2.2如何限制访问权限?

-设置用户权限:为用户分配不同的权限,如只读、读写等,限制其访问范围。

-使用角色权限:通过角色管理,将用户分组,并为角色分配权限,实现权限的集中管理。

三、限制dblink的访问时间

3.1为什么要限制访问时间?

限制访问时间可以防止恶意攻击,保障数据库安全。

3.2如何限制访问时间?

-设置访问时间段:在数据库配置文件中设置允许访问的时间段,如仅在工作时间内允许访问。

-使用访问控制列表(ACL):通过ACL技术,对特定IP地址或IP段进行访问限制。

四、限制dblink的访问频率

4.1为什么要限制访问频率?

限制访问频率可以防止恶意攻击和滥用,保障数据库安全。

4.2如何限制访问频率?

-使用防火墙:通过防火墙限制特定IP地址或IP段的访问频率。

-使用访问控制策略:在数据库中设置访问控制策略,限制特定用户或角色的访问频率。

五、限制dblink的访问数据量

5.1为什么要限制访问数据量?

限制访问数据量可以防止数据泄露和滥用,保障数据安全。

5.2如何限制访问数据量?

-设置查询限制:在数据库配置文件中设置查询限制,如限制查询结果数量。

-使用存储过程:将数据处理逻辑封装在存储过程中,限制用户直接访问数据。

通过以上方法,我们可以有效地限制dblink的访问,保障数据库安全、优化性能和提升运维效率。在实际应用中,应根据具体需求选择合适的方法,实现数据库链接的有效管理。